#1a55be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a55be is composed of 10.2% red, 33.3%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 42.4%. #1a55be color hex could be obtained by blending #34aaff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1a55be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1a55be has RGB values of R:26, G:85,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 1725886.

Shades and Tints of #1a55be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eef3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a55be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656a73 is the less saturated color, while #014ed7 is the most saturated one.
